在当今数字化时代,网站和应用程序的高效运行离不开稳定的数据库支持。对于使用百度智能云虚拟主机进行建站的用户而言,了解并遵循数据库管理的最佳实践是确保数据安全、性能优化以及系统稳定的关键步骤。以下将从几个重要方面探讨如何实现最佳的数据库管理。
一、选择合适的数据库类型
不同的应用场景适合不同类型的数据库,如关系型数据库(MySQL)适用于结构化数据存储;非关系型数据库(MongoDB)则更适合处理大量半结构化或非结构化的数据。根据业务需求合理选择数据库类型,可以提高查询效率,降低开发成本。
二、定期备份与恢复测试
数据丢失风险始终存在,因此定期备份至关重要。利用百度智能云提供的自动化备份工具,按照设定的时间间隔自动完*量或增量备份,并确保备份文件的安全存储。还需定期进行恢复演练,以验证备份的有效性,确保在紧急情况下能够迅速恢复数据。
三、实施有效的权限管理
为避免因权限设置不当导致的安全隐患,应遵循最小权限原则,即只授予用户完成其工作所需的最低限度权限。通过角色分配和细粒度控制,限制对敏感信息的访问,同时记录所有操作日志以便审计追踪。
四、优化查询性能
随着业务增长,数据库规模不断扩大,查询速度可能会受到影响。为此,可以通过创建索引、调整表结构等方式来优化查询语句;采用缓存机制减少重复查询也是提升响应速度的有效手段之一。
五、监控与故障排除
实时监控数据库运行状态有助于及时发现潜在问题,防止小故障演变成大灾难。借助百度智能云提供的监控服务,可以直观地查看各项指标变化趋势,一旦出现异常情况立即触发告警通知相关人员采取措施。对于已发生的故障,则要深入分析原因,总结经验教训,不断完善应急预案。
六、保持软件更新
无论是操作系统还是数据库管理系统本身,都需要定期检查是否有新的版本发布。及时安装补丁不仅可以修复已知漏洞,还能获得厂商提供的新特性支持,从而增强系统的安全性与稳定性。
在百度智能云虚拟主机环境下进行网站搭建时,科学合理的数据库管理是保障项目成功的重要因素。希望以上提到的最佳实践能为广大开发者提供有益参考,助力大家构建更加安全可靠的应用程序。
文章推荐更多>
- 1oracle怎么查询存储过程最近编译时间记录
- 2免费看短剧的网站有哪些?在线免费看短剧的网站top10推荐
- 3redis和mysql数据不一致怎么解决
- 4电脑截图键盘怎么操作 键盘截图功能使用指南
- 5redis的五种数据类型命令有哪些
- 6wordpress如何更换域名
- 7oracle数据库怎么运行sql
- 8wordpress怎么上传本地的视频教程
- 9mysql和redis怎么保证双写一致性
- 10如何给mysql配置环境变量
- 11oracle如何备份数据库数据
- 12oracle怎么恢复删除掉的表
- 13mysql是什么类型的数据库?
- 14俄罗斯引擎官网登录入口手机版 俄罗斯搜索引擎官网手机版入口
- 15wordpress是怎么添加登录的
- 16渗透测试流程:KaliLinux信息收集与漏洞利用
- 17wordpress主题怎么本地安装
- 18oracle如何查看数据库
- 19mysql数据恢复主要采用什么命令执行
- 20怎么把wordpress文章发布到网站
- 21如何配置mysql的环境变量
- 22电脑一直卡在白屏状态怎么办 白屏卡死解决方法轻松恢复系统
- 23oracle数据库查询数据文件地址怎么查
- 24mysql命令行怎么打开
- 25电脑键盘哪个是开机键 键盘开机功能键说明
- 26docker环境怎么安装WordPress
- 27俄罗斯搜索引擎入口在哪里 俄罗斯引擎入口进入
- 28oracle数据库怎么查询数据
- 29uc浏览器怎么免费解压文件 uc免会员解压文件详细图文教程
- 30怎么登陆dedecms后台
